Marc Notes: Includes bibliographical references and index. Biographical Note: Mehdi Aminrazavi is Professor of Philosophy and Religion at the University of Mary Washington. He is the author of "The Wine of Wisdom: The Life, Poetry, and Philosophy of Omar Khayyam" and the coeditor (with David Ambuel) of "Philosophy, Religion, and the Question of Intolerance," also published by SUNY Press.
